The third season of the German singing casting show Deutschland sucht den Superstar was broadcast from November 16, 2005 to March 18, 2006. The previous moderators have been replaced by Tooske Ragas and Marco Schreyl . The show magazine was moderated by Nina Moghaddam and David Wilms . The jury was reduced to three people, and most of them were newly appointed; In addition to Dieter Bohlen, Sylvia Kollek and Heinz Henn evaluated the candidates. The final was contested by Mike Leon Grosch and Tobias Regner , who just managed to prevail.

Semifinals
Mike Leon Grosch, Vanessa Jean Dedmon and Tobias Regner fought for the two tickets to the final on March 11, 2006. For the first time this season, each candidate sang three songs. The motto of the semi-final was cozy skirt . Each candidate dedicated the third song to a specific person.
At the end of the evening, Mike Leon Grosch and Tobias Regner were voted into the final by the audience. Vanessa Jean Dedmon didn't have enough calls and was eliminated shortly before the final.

final
On March 18, Mike Leon Grosch and Tobias Regner fought for the 2006 Superstar title . In the first round, the opponents sang a song of their choice, then a song that they had already sung in a live show and in the third round everyone sang their winning title.
Tobias Regner is the winner of the third season and thus superstar 2006 .
